BUZZARDS BAY – If you enjoy long bicycle rides and care about Buzzards Bay, this event is just for you.
The Buzzards Bay Watershed Ride kicks off in just two weeks, and there’s still time to register alongside over 200 participants. The ride is brought to you by the Buzzards Bay Coalition.
The ride down the 35-mile length of Buzzards Bay travels through coastal areas, farmland, working waterfronts and quaint villages all the way down to a seaside celebration in Woods Hole.
The adventure is friendly for bicyclists of all ages and experience levels.
Eight time Watershed Ride participant Karl Audenaerde says he rights not only because he loves bicycling, but because he also loves Buzzards Bay.
“The Ride combines something I like doing with something I consider important: keeping the place I live in working order,” said Audenaerde.
The Buzzards Bay Watershed Ride is scheduled for September 30.
